Yes, that can be done, but it requires vba code attached to the checkbox in Word that starts Access, opens the database file, selects the required record or whatever, then updates the Access checkbox. This requires considerable code just for error-checking (eg is Access already running, is the database already open), quite apart from the code that actually does the work.
